The City of Perth manages and operates the 24-hour Convention Centre Car Park under an exclusive arrangement with the Perth Convention and Exhibition Centre. This allows event organisers the option to offer and coordinate advanced parking passes provided it meets their strict booking conditions.

Keen2connect (K2C) recognise the inconvenience if exhibitors are unable to park during the event period. Given the popularity of this convenient parking location, particularly during weekdays, K2C offers this service to provide exhibitors with the option to guarantee their parking for a stress-free arrival.

KEY INFORMATION

  • RESERVED PARKING PASS: $50 per bay, per day. Parking without a pass is subject to availability.
  • NO CHANGES/REFUNDS: K2C are required to confirm total parking passes by COB Friday, 28 MARCH 2025.
  • PRICE CHANGES: City of Perth reserves the right to change prices with 60 days' notice. Prices are fixed once paid.

    INSTRUCTIONS

  • 1. PROCESS: Complete the form with the number of bays required for each day and submit by FRIDAY 28 MARCH 2025.
    2. INVOICE AND PAYMENT: An invoice will be sent upon order confirmation. Payment must be received by MONDAY 31 MARCH 2025.
    3. PASS COLLECTION: Prior to parking your vehicle, please collect your parking passes from the Careers Expo desk, located in the foyer outside Pavilion 4 on WEDNESDAY, 14 MAY 2025 (13.00– 18.00) or THURSDAY, 15 MAY 2025 (7.00 - 9:00).
    4. PASS RULES: Passes permit one-time entry per day. No specific bays allocated. Entry from Mounts Bay Road opposite Mill Street.

    Unfortunately, K2C are unable to accept any orders after the deadline. For casual parking fees and real-time bay availability, visit www.cityofperthparking.com.au.

    It is a condition of your participation in the Careers Expo 2025 ("the Event") that your organisation ("the Client") demonstrates to Keen2connect it holds an insurance policy which includes Product and Public Liability cover with a minimum of $10 million. The cover must respond to any claim against damage or injury caused to third parties/visitors on or in the vicinity of your exhibition stand ("the Stand") be valid for the period ending no sooner than midnight on 19 May 2025.

    To comply with this, your organisation must provide a copy of the Certificate of Currency for its insurance policy evidencing the minimum coverage of $10 million per claim. The Certificate of Currency must be received by Keen2connect no later than 2 May 2025 and be valid until the period ending at midnight on 19 May 2025.
